Compliance With Mine Plan <br />R - Other <br />NA - Processing Waste <br />Y - Roads <br />N - Reclamation Success <br />N - Revegetation <br />NA - Subsidence <br />NA - Slides and Other Damage <br />• -Support Facilities On -site <br />• -Signs and Markers <br />NA - Support Facilities Not On -site <br />R - Special Categories Of Mining <br />R -Topsoil <br />GENERAL COMMENTS <br />On February 17, the Division received TDN -Y11 -140 -117 -001 from the Office of Surface <br />Mining. This TDN was issued in response to a citizen complaint from JoEllen Turner, and <br />interprets her allegations to mean that "suitable subsoil material was not handled or stored in a <br />manner that would prevent contamination which would lessen the capacity of the material to <br />support vegetation when redistributed." This inspection was initially scheduled as part of the <br />Division's normal I & E program; the timing of the inspection also provided an opportunity to <br />investigate the violations alleged with this TDN. <br />AIR RESOURCE PROTECTION —Rule 4.17: <br />The water truck was observed, spraying the southern ramp into the pit (Photo 1). <br />EXPLOSIVES — Rule 4.08 <br />The drill rig was drilling a pattern on the parcel owned by WFC (Photo 2). A completed drill <br />pattern was established a distance north of where the rig was located, but had not yet been loaded <br />for the next shot. <br />FISH and WILDLIFE — Rule 4.18: <br />A variety of ducks were congregating at Pond 007, where the ice has partially melted and open <br />water was available. <br />GENERAL MINE PLAN COMPLANCE: <br />The Mine Shovel was not in operation at the time of the inspection, so the mine's haul trucks <br />were parked.
